Compensation

Compensation from a mesothelioma case can be used to pay for the cost of treatment and other expenses associated with this life-altering disease. A victim is able to file a mesothelioma lawsuit or an appeal to a trust fund to receive compensation. Both types of claims provide financial relief to victims and their family members.

Family members or victims of the incident file lawsuits to hold asbestos-exposed companies accountable. They are filed in civil courts and are governed by the laws of each state. Asbestos lawsuits may take several years before a settlement is reached. However, mesothelioma lawyers can accelerate the process by filing many cases at once or "clustered".

Companies that mined asbestos, manufactured asbestos-containing goods or exposed their employees in any other way to the harmful substance, created trust funds. Asbestos sufferers can file a mesothelioma trust fund claim to receive a lump sum payout to cover medical costs and other expenses.

While health insurance can cover some mesothelioma treatment costs but many patients face substantial out-of-pocket costs. This type of cancer may also prevent a patient from working, leading to an income loss. mesothelioma lawsuits (you could try this out) and trust fund claims may help victims recover lost wages, future earnings, and other losses.

Compensation can be used to cover the cost of living, such as hiring a caregiver or transportation. Asbestos-related diseases may qualify for disability benefits through Social Security. The VA also offers monthly payments to veterans with mesothelioma as well as other asbestos-related ailments.

Veteran benefits

A person who has a mesothelioma diagnosis may be eligible for VA benefits to pay for medical treatment. Veterans may be eligible for disability compensation and pensions, based on the severity of their disease. They should work with an attorney that is accredited by the VA to ensure that they fill out all required forms and fulfill any requirements.

The VA provides treatment by some of the top mesothelioma experts in the nation. The VA has two mesothelioma thoracic surgeons that are world-renowned: Dr. Daniel Wiener in Boston and Dr. Robert Cameron in Los Angeles. The VA will pay for travel costs in the event that the local VA refers a patient suffering from mesothelioma or other cancer to one of these surgeons.

The VA offers home healthcare benefits that help reduce the cost of hiring a person to help a mesothelioma patient with their daily tasks. These benefits are known as Aid and Attendance. To be eligible for these benefits, a veteran must meet certain requirements, such as the need for someone to assist them in bathing and dressing or eat. A mesothelioma attorney can provide a detailed explanation of these requirements and assist veterans in completing the required paperwork to claim the benefits.

In addition, a mesothelioma attorney can assist a veteran to file an application for mesothelioma that is service-related or other asbestos-related ailments with the VA. The process can take up to months, however VA-certified attorneys have assisted many veterans in getting their claims approved swiftly.

Children and spouses of veterans who have died from mesothelioma or another asbestos-related disease, could be eligible to receive education benefits. These benefits may help pay for college, career education or apprenticeships. These benefits are provided through the Survivors and Dependents Educational Assistance Program (DEA or Chapter 35).
